Input lock

"Input lock" freezes the measuring value. "Input Lock" can be helpful, for example, in case of
known interferences to prevent feeding these interferences into the filters of the analog input
module.
There are various "Input lock" options.
QByte
x
Input lock A
Once input lock A is activated, no new measured values are fed into the filters of the analog
input module. The measured value in the process image input is frozen. Only by stopping input
lock A is the measured value refreshed again or the module-internal filters supplied with new
values.
Input lock B
Once input lock B is activated, the measured value in the process image input is frozen. After
stopping input lock B, the measured value is prefiltered and refreshed again. This prefiltering
is done with a configurable average value filter (see prefilter Input lock B).
Note
Switching between Input lock A and Input lock B
It is not possible to switch directly between Input lock A and Input lock B.
● To change to a different input lock you must stop the currently active input lock.
